Gravel Parking Lot Grading in Houston, TX
Gravel parking lot grading services involve adjusting the surface of a gravel area to ensure proper drainage, stability, and a smooth, level surface. These services are commonly requested for driveways, parking areas, or storage yards that require an even foundation to prevent pooling water, erosion, or uneven settling. Property owners often seek grading to improve safety, accessibility, and the longevity of their gravel surfaces, especially before adding new gravel or after noticing issues like ruts or washouts.
Before requesting gravel parking lot grading, property owners should consider the current condition of the surface, including existing drainage patterns and any areas prone to flooding or water accumulation. Understanding the scope of the project-such as the size of the area, desired slope, and any existing features-helps ensure the grading work effectively addresses specific concerns. Clear communication about these details can lead to a more efficient process and a long-lasting, well-maintained gravel surface.

Gravel Parking Lot Grading Questions
What is gravel parking lot grading? It is the process of leveling and shaping a gravel surface to improve drainage and stability for parking areas.
Why is grading important for gravel lots? Proper grading helps prevent water pooling, reduces erosion, and extends the lifespan of the parking surface.
What types of projects typically require gravel parking lot grading? Projects include new gravel lots, existing lot repairs, and drainage improvements for driveways or parking areas.
How does gravel parking lot grading benefit property owners? It enhances safety, minimizes maintenance issues, and ensures a more even and durable parking surface.
